二、簡單應(yīng)用(2小題,每題20分,計40分)
在考生文件夾下,完成如下簡單應(yīng)用:
1. 打開程序文件progerr.prg,按文件中給出的功能要求改正其中的錯誤,
以文件名prognew.prg重新保存該文件并運行程序。
2.建立如圖所示頂層表單,表單文件名為myform.scx,表單控件名為myform,
表單標(biāo)題為"頂層表單"。
為頂層表單建立菜單mymenu。菜單欄如圖所示(無下拉菜單),單擊"退出"
菜單時,關(guān)閉釋放此頂層表單,并返回到系統(tǒng)菜單(在過程中完成)。
本題主要考核點:
表單控件的屬性的修改、SQL語句運用、菜單建立、頂層表單的設(shè)計等知識點。本題解題思路:
第一小題:本題是一個程序修改題。根據(jù)題目要求,程序中的語句應(yīng)是:
CREATE view viewes AS SELECT 職工號,SUM(金額) AS 總金額 FROM orders GROUP BY 職工號
SELECT * FROM viewes WHERE 總金額>=30000 ORDER BY 總金額 DESC INTO TABLE newtable.dbf
第二小題:
1.建立表單:可通過"文件"菜單下的"新建"命令或用命令CREATE FORM打開表單設(shè)計器。
2.修改表單各屬性值,NAME="myform",CAPTION="頂層表單"。將表單以myform.scx為文件名保存在考生文件夾下。
3.建立菜單:
可通過"文件"菜單下的"新建"命令或用命令CREATE MEMU打開菜單設(shè)計器。點擊"顯示"菜單下的"常規(guī)選項"命令打開"常規(guī)選項"對話框,選中"頂層表單"復(fù)選框。在菜單設(shè)計器中建立各菜單項,菜單名稱分別為:文件、編輯、退出。"退出"菜單項的結(jié)果列為"過程",并通過單擊"編輯"按鈕打開一個窗中來添加"退出"菜單項要執(zhí)行的命令myform.release來關(guān)閉表單并返回到系統(tǒng)菜單。最后點擊"菜單"下的"生成"命令生成.mpr程序。
4.將表單myform.scx中的ShowWindow屬性設(shè)計為"2-作為頂層表單",并在表單的LOAD事件中輸入"do mymenu.mpr with this,.t."執(zhí)行菜單程序。
5.保存表單,并運行。
北京 | 天津 | 上海 | 江蘇 | 山東 |
安徽 | 浙江 | 江西 | 福建 | 深圳 |
廣東 | 河北 | 湖南 | 廣西 | 河南 |
海南 | 湖北 | 四川 | 重慶 | 云南 |
貴州 | 西藏 | 新疆 | 陜西 | 山西 |
寧夏 | 甘肅 | 青海 | 遼寧 | 吉林 |
黑龍江 | 內(nèi)蒙古 |